Emily The Strange - The First Movie Adapted From A Sticker? By Peter Sciretta/May 30, 2008 2:17 am EST Emily the Strange was created by Santa Cruz skateboarder Rob Reger in the early 1990’s to help promote his company Cosmic Debris Etc. Inc. Before becoming a cult counterculture icon, Emily began on a sticker that was passed out for free at concerts, record stores and skate shops to help promote Cosmic Debris....
